Porter-Gaud and First Baptist School are an even 5-5 against one another  since March of 2018, but likely not for long. The Cyclones are taking a road trip to  challenge the Hurricanes  at 5:00  p.m.  on Monday. The teams are on pretty different trajectories at the moment (Porter-Gaud has three straight  wins, First Baptist School has three straight  defeats), but none of that matters once you're on the field.
Last Thursday, Porter-Gaud beat Northwood Academy 9-5.
 Brooklyn Ellis was  incredible,  scoring two  runs while  getting on base  in all four of his plate appearances.  Dylan Brinker was another key player,  scoring a  run while going 1-for-3.
 Porter-Gaud  always had someone on base and  finished the game having  posted an OBP of .514.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Northwood Academy only posted  an  OBP of  .323.
 Meanwhile, First Baptist School came up short against Pinewood Prep on Thursday and fell  7-2.
 First Baptist School's loss dropped their record down to 12-6-1. As for Porter-Gaud, their victory bumped their record up to 6-4.
 Porter-Gaud was able to grind out a solid  win over First Baptist School in their previous meeting  back in April of 2024, winning  12-8. The rematch might be a little tougher for the Cyclones since the  squad won't have the home-field adv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
